About the Role
This position manages daily power plant operations and production activities, directing resources to achieve plant availability and reliability requirements in accordance with standardized operating procedures. The role analyzes plant operations and makes recommendations for improving performance related to safety, availability, reliability, efficiency, and operating cost.
Responsibilities
- Direct operators in all aspects of power plant operations.
- Manage daily production activities for the plant(s).
- Review operating data to ensure economic operation, compliance with safety procedures, correction of deficiencies, and permit requirements.
- Develop, implement, update, and maintain operations and maintenance plans, procedures, checklists, site policies, training and safety programs, and work practices.
- Oversee plant maintenance compliance with permit conditions, environmental health and safety programs, local laws, ordinances, and standards.
- Monitor and implement regulatory requirements.
- Develop and implement operator training programs and maintain operator qualifications.
- Manage water treatment programs.
- Coordinate and review plant safety programs, including required training for lock-out/tag-out procedures, confined space entry, and hot work permits.
- Coordinate with purchasing and warehouse to acquire parts and materials.
- Assist in engineering and implementing plant upgrades and modifications.
- Prepare, review, and analyze daily equipment log sheets, alarm conditions, and other operational data.
- Document abnormal conditions and perform root cause analysis; formulate solutions to minimize recurrence.
- Assess plant systems and equipment for routine repairs and maintenance in coordination with the Plant Manager and Maintenance Manager; initiate work order requests in the Computerized Maintenance Management System.
- Plan and prepare capital and operating budgets relating to division and contracts.
- Routinely inspect generation equipment, auxiliary systems, outbuildings, and main structures.
- Verify that appropriate unit testing is performed and documented.
- Prepare, review, and approve documents, records, work orders, and reports.
- Establish initiatives and manage objectives aligned with Chugach’s overall strategic goals.
- Prepare and administer employee performance reviews.
- Plan for staffing, training, and development of department personnel.
- Support continuous improvement and operational efficiency by identifying areas of opportunity and sharing recommendations.
- Other duties as assigned.
